A veteran journalist with a passion for truth and storytelling, Jim Willse has led some of the most influential newspapers in the country. As editor of The New York Daily News (1989-1993) and The Star-Ledger (1995-2011), he championed investigative journalism, guiding teams to win two Pulitzer Prizes and secure eight finalist nominations. His leadership was recognized in 2000 when he was named Editor of the Year by the National Press Foundation. With a sharp eye for compelling narratives, Jim has also shaped the next generation of writers, teaching nonfiction courses at Princeton University. His love for the written word and dedication to public service continue to drive his involvement with Planetwalk.
